Rising vehicle rental costs, shifting economic pressures, and growing awareness around hidden fees have shifted how U.S. travelers approach bookings. With inflation-mixed memories of rental surcharges and tight travel budgets, the deposit process is no longer just a routine formality—it’s a key moment of transparency. More users expect upfront clarity and feel empowered to verify terms before committing, making education on deposits both timely and timely.
